      • Black Hawk Down is a 2001 war film directed and produced by Ridley Scott, and co-produced by Jerry Bruckheimer, from a screenplay by Ken Nolan. It is based on the 1999 eponymous non-fiction book by journalist Mark Bowden, about the crew of a Black Hawk helicopter that was shot down during the Battle of Mogadishu.

    While not affecting the plot itself, a major issue with the film is its representation. Set in Mogadishu, Somalia, the film bafflingly manages to exclude any actual Somalis in its featured roles (mostly on account of the film shooting its majority in Morocco).
